Taming Inflation: Raising Interest Rates as a Weapon

Inflation persists a pressing challenge for many economies worldwide. As prices climb, central banks often turn to interest rate hikes as a key mechanism to curb inflation's spread.

  • Boosting interest rates, central banks seek to make borrowing dearer. This can dampen consumer and business spending, which in turn can ease inflation.
  • On the other hand, interest rate hikes can also have adverse consequences for economic development. A sharp increase in rates can result in a economic downturn.

As a result, central banks must judiciously calibrate interest rate increases to find a balance between curbing price increases and supporting economic growth.

The Price Tag on Femininity: Battling the Pink Tax Amidst Rising Costs

Inflation is hitting everyone hard, but for women, the burden can be particularly pronounced. This is due in part to the persistent "Pink Tax," a phenomenon where products marketed towards women are often costlier than comparable products for men. From razors and shampoo to clothing and haircuts, women are consistently laying out more for everyday essentials simply because they are labeled as feminine. While it might seem like a small difference, these added costs escalate over time, creating a significant financial disparity for women.

The Pink Tax worsens existing inequalities and reinforces harmful gender stereotypes. By recognizing this problem, we can make a difference to combat it. This includes demanding policies that promote price transparency, examining gender-based pricing practices, and empowering women to conscious purchasing decisions.
